WebJohn Brian Francis "Jack" Gaughan, pronounced like 'gone' (September 24, 1930 – July 21, 1985), [1] was an American science fiction artist and illustrator who won the Hugo Award several times. WebApr 10, 2024 · Here are 5 of the most popular artists who focus on creating engaging works of science fiction. 1. Jim Burns. Tertiary Node by Jim Burns, via Infected by Art; with Tour of the Universe by Jim Burns, 1970, via Le Vagabond Des Etoiles. Born in 1948 in Wales, Jim Burns has been called one of the “Grand Masters” of science fiction art.
